WebYou will need to check the drainpipe underneath and make the nut in it tight. If this does not work, remove all the parts there, including the P-trap and the drain. Then wrap the drain using a plumbers tape or add a plumber’s putty between then reassemble the pieces back. WebFollowing the manufacturer’s instructions, wrap a length of plumbers tape around the threads of the pipe. Move the P trap back into position with the draining pipe and reconnect the pipes with the coupling nut. Tighten both coupling nuts. Run water to check if the …

WebOct 19, 2024 · Bathroom Sink Leaking Underneath at the Tailpiece Unscrew the tailpiece with a wrench. If it’s made of brass, it can be easily crushed so try to unscrew those by hand. For a better grip, here’s a pro tip: slip a wide rubber band onto the tailpiece. This will keep your hand from slipping while trying to loosen the tailpiece.

Remove the handle. Then turn the valve counterclockwise with a wrench. Pull out the valve. Laundry faucets like this are easy and cheap to fix. If it’s dripping from the spout, you need a new faucet washer. And if water is leaking around the handle, the rubber O-ring around the valve stem is bad. novara and abby park
